A Solar Traffic Light is a traffic signal powered by solar energy, reducing reliance on electricity grids. These lights use solar panels to absorb sunlight during the day and store it in batteries for night-time operation, providing efficient and eco-friendly traffic management in various settings.

Understanding Solar Traffic Lights: Technology & Benefits

Solar Traffic Lights are an innovative solution for managing urban mobility, offering a sustainable and efficient approach to traffic control. These lights utilize solar energy, harnessing the power of the sun to operate and maintain their functions, which sets them apart from conventional traffic lighting systems. Understanding the technology behind Solar Traffic Lights is crucial to comprehending their benefits and potential impact on cities. The process involves the integration of solar panels, typically installed on poles or structures, which capture sunlight during the day. These panels charge a battery system, ensuring a consistent power supply even in low-light conditions.

Installation & Maintenance: A Step-by-Step Guide

The installation and maintenance of a solar traffic light system is a process that requires careful consideration and expert execution. This step-by-step guide provides an in-depth look at what to expect when implementing this sustainable solution for managing urban traffic flow.

The first step involves assessing your location's suitability for solar power, considering factors like sunlight exposure and weather patterns. Once qualified, the process begins with selecting a reputable provider. Researching their experience, technology, and customer reviews is crucial to ensure you receive a high-quality system. The provider will then conduct an on-site survey, evaluating your specific needs and designing a custom solution. This includes determining the number of lights required and their strategic placement for optimal efficiency.

Installation typically takes several days, depending on the scale of the project. It involves mounting solar panels in locations with unobstructed sunlight access and installing the lighting fixtures. The panels charge the batteries during the day, enabling nighttime illumination without relying on traditional electricity grids. Regular maintenance is minimal but essential to keep the system functioning optimally. This includes cleaning the panels periodically to ensure maximum sunlight absorption and inspecting the lights for any damage or performance issues.

Frequently Asked Questions About Solar Traffic Light

What is a solar traffic light? A solar traffic light is a traffic signal that operates using energy from solar panels, instead of traditional electric grids. It harnesses sunlight during the day and stores it in batteries for nighttime operation, providing a sustainable and efficient alternative to conventional lighting.

How does a solar traffic light work? Solar traffic lights consist of solar panels mounted on poles or structures, which capture sunlight and convert it into electricity. This energy is stored in rechargeable batteries, allowing the lights to function even without direct sunlight. At night, the batteries power the LED bulbs, ensuring clear visibility and safe navigation for pedestrians and vehicles.

Are solar traffic lights cost-effective? Absolutely. While the initial installation cost might be higher than traditional lights, solar traffic lights offer long-term savings. They reduce electricity bills, require minimal maintenance, and have a longer lifespan, making them a cost-efficient solution for both municipalities and private properties.

Where are solar traffic lights commonly used? Solar traffic lights are versatile and can be deployed in various settings. Common applications include pedestrian crossings, residential neighborhoods, parks, and remote areas with limited access to traditional power grids. Their off-grid capabilities make them ideal for locations where electricity is scarce or difficult to obtain.

Do solar traffic lights require much maintenance? Solar traffic lights are designed for minimal upkeep. The primary tasks involve cleaning the panels periodically to maintain optimal sunlight exposure and replacing batteries every few years, depending on usage and environmental conditions. Most manufacturers offer maintenance support to ensure the longevity of their products.

Can solar traffic lights operate in all weather conditions? These lights are built to withstand various weather conditions. Modern solar traffic lights feature robust designs, including water-resistant and dustproof casing, ensuring they can function in rain, snow, or dusty environments. However, extreme weather events may temporarily affect their performance, but they quickly recover once conditions improve.

Are solar traffic lights environmentally friendly? Yes, they are an eco-friendly option. By relying on renewable energy from the sun, these lights reduce carbon emissions and the environmental impact associated with traditional electricity generation. They contribute to a more sustainable future by minimizing the ecological footprint of urban infrastructure.
